Srinagar

Vice chairman of Jammu and Kashmir Khadi and Village Industries Board (KVIB)  and Senior PDP leader Peerzada Mansoor Hussain on Wednesday resigned from his position.

In a resignation letter to Governor NN Vohra, Mansoor wrote, “That being a General Secretary of the J&K PDP, I hereby find my self-duty bound to resign from the post of VC J J&K KVIB.”

The development came a day after BJP pulled out of the coalition with PDP and paved way for the governor’s rule.
